A video about Amami Oshima Island has been released

A stunning island with pristine nature, Amami Oshima Island lies about 380 km southwest of Kyushu region. It is an attractive island where unique and abundant nature such as sub-tropical laurel forests and mangrove forests remain untouched, and the cultures of Okinawa, ancient Japan, and Asia coexist.

